谷歌浏览器的网络监测工具介绍
随着互联网的快速发展,网络监测在日常生活和工作中显得愈发重要。为了帮助开发者和用户更好地利用网络资源,谷歌浏览器(Chrome)内置了一套强大的网络监测工具。这些工具不仅可以帮助开发者调试和优化网页,还可以为普通用户提供网络使用情况的透明度。本文将为您详细介绍谷歌浏览器的网络监测工具及其使用方法。
首先,我们需要了解如何打开谷歌浏览器的网络监测工具。只需右键点击页面空白处,选择“检查”(或使用快捷键F12),打开开发者工具。然后,在开发者工具下方,选择“网络”标签。此时,您将看到一个实时显示网络请求和响应的面板。
网络监测工具主要由以下几个部分组成:
1. **请求列表**:在网络面板的左侧,您可以看到所有的网络请求,包括HTML文档、JavaScript文件、CSS样式表、图像和API请求等。每一个请求都会显示请求的状态码、文件类型、请求时间和大小等信息。
2. **筛选器**:为了便于分析,网络面板提供了多种筛选功能。您可以根据请求类型(如XHR、JS、CSS、图片等)进行过滤,以便专注于您关心的特定请求。这对于减少信息干扰,提高调试效率至关重要。
3. **分页与监测时间线**:请求列表是实时更新的,您可以看到每个请求的加载时间、响应时间和下载时间等信息。这些数据可以帮助您找到加载缓慢的资源,从而进行优化。此外,工具还可以预览加载的资源,方便您检查文件内容。
4. **请求详细信息**:点击某个请求后,右侧面板会显示该请求的详细信息,包括请求头、响应头、请求负载、响应内容等。这一部分对开发者尤其重要,能够帮助他们分析请求的数据格式和服务器响应的质量。
5. **性能监测**:在网络面板的右侧,有一个“水瀑布”图表,直观地展示了所有请求的加载时间。通过此图表,您可以很容易地看到每个请求的耗时和总的加载时间,而这对于优化网页性能至关重要。
6. **HTTP/2和Protocol Monitoring**:对现代网页应用而言,HTTP/2和其他协议的支持至关重要。网络监测工具能够检测并跟踪不同类型协议的使用情况,帮助开发者更好地理解如何提升网站性能。
最后,谷歌浏览器的网络监测工具不仅限于分析请求和响应,它还提供了导出功能,允许用户将监测数据保存为HAR文件。这对于持续监测或分享网络数据给同事非常有用。
综上所述,谷歌浏览器的网络监测工具为开发者提供了强大的功能,帮助他们分析和优化网页性能,并为用户提供了透明的网络使用查看方式。通过充分利用这些工具,您可以更有效地应对日益增长的网络需求,提升网页加载速度,改善用户体验。无论您是开发者还是普通用户,掌握这些工具的使用都将对您的互联网体验大有裨益。